Making Best Use Of Thermal Effectiveness
To attain maximum thermal effectiveness in contemporary buildings, spray foam insulation is an outstanding selection. This insulation type is understood for its remarkable capability to block warm transfer, which is crucial in preserving a constant indoor temperature year-round. Unlike conventional insulation products, spray foam broadens upon setup, filling gaps and creating a limited seal. This prevents thermal linking, a typical problem where heat leaves through uninsulated areas of the structure envelope. By lessening warm loss and gain, spray foam insulation enhances the building's thermal efficiency, minimizing the stress on heating and cooling down systems.
